TREBLEET 80Gbps eGPU Enclosure, Thunderbolt 5 & USB4, JHL9480 Controller

TREBLEET 80Gbps eGPU Enclosure, Thunderbolt 5 & USB4, JHL9480 Controller
JHL9480 controller, 80Gbps bandwidth140W PD chargingSFX/ATX/FLEX/DC power support

About this pick

The officially certified JHL9480 controller delivers a genuine 80Gbps bandwidth, twice the previous generation, specifically built for Thunderbolt 5 and USB4 standards. A downstream high-speed port supports daisy-chaining additional storage or displays alongside the GPU connection.

Up to 140W Power Delivery fast-charges a laptop through the same single cable running the external GPU, and power supply compatibility spans SFX, ATX, FLEX, and DC input (19.5-20V), with the DC input specifically noted as better suited to low-power cards like capture cards. The listing is direct that this requires real driver and compatibility knowledge to set up correctly.

Mini eGPU Enclosure Thunderbolt 3/4, USB4 40Gbps External GPU Dock

Mini eGPU Enclosure Thunderbolt 3/4, USB4 40Gbps External GPU Dock
JHL7440 controllerDetailed pre-purchase compatibility check providedSFX/ATX/FLEX/DC power support

About this pick

The listing is unusually direct about verifying real Thunderbolt/USB4 support before buying, walking through exactly how to check for Intel and AMD systems in Device Manager, a genuinely useful pre-purchase compatibility check most listings skip. The officially certified JHL7440 controller backs stable expansion performance.

It explicitly does not recommend handheld gaming console compatibility, worth noting if that's your intended use case. A second TB3 port and USB-A port let it function as a hub for additional Thunderbolt devices, and power supply compatibility spans SFX, ATX, FLEX, and DC (19.5-20V), with a specific warning that DC power only suits PCIe devices that don't need external power.

How We Evaluated These Portable eGPU Enclosures

Each pick was assessed across 5 criteria weighted for real-world use.

Host-Link Architecture Verified

Checked the exact host port type, controller generation, and effective PCIe path rather than trusting a USB-C connector alone as proof of eGPU support.

GPU Physical Fit Documented

Compared maximum supported GPU length, height, slot width, and power-connector clearance against real current graphics cards.

Power Supply and Charging Verified Separately

Checked PSU wattage and format separately from any laptop charging (Power Delivery) figure, since these are two different specifications often blended in marketing.

Host and OS Compatibility Confirmed

Verified documented compatibility across Windows, macOS, and Linux hosts, noting where support is limited to specific chip generations or OS versions.

Ownership Details: Cables, Noise, and Support

Weighed included cables, fan noise, warranty length, and driver support quality as part of the real cost of eGPU ownership, not just the enclosure price.

How much GPU performance do I lose running it externally versus internally?

Some loss is normal since even Thunderbolt 5's 80Gbps trails a native PCIe x16 slot's bandwidth, but the real-world impact varies by workload: GPU-bound gaming and rendering see a smaller hit than bandwidth-sensitive tasks. Check for real benchmark comparisons on your specific host and GPU pairing rather than assuming a fixed percentage.

Do all Thunderbolt-equipped Macs support eGPUs?

No. Apple's official eGPU support is specific to Intel-based Thunderbolt 3 Macs; Apple Silicon Macs (M1 and later) do not officially support external GPUs for graphics acceleration, regardless of port type. Check Apple's current documentation for your specific Mac before assuming compatibility.

Should I choose a Thunderbolt/USB4 enclosure or an OCuLink one?

Thunderbolt and USB4 tunnel PCIe over a general-purpose port shared with other data, while OCuLink provides a more direct PCIe connection with typically lower overhead, but neither hot-plugs as easily and OCuLink support is far less common on laptops. Match the choice to what your specific host actually exposes.
